Dealing with Student Diversity through the Case-Study Approach.
Boyce, B. Ann
Journal of Physical Education, Recreation and Dance, v67 n5 p46-50 May-Jun 1996
A case study approach can help preservice teachers develop effective strategies for handling situations that arise as they teach diverse students in public schools. This article presents teaching hints for the case study approach, offering a sample scenario for a seventh-grade middle school physical education class. (SM)
